What Types Of Business Insurance Are There?

There are many types of business insurance, and the type you need depends on your business. Property, liability, and workers’ compensation are the most common business insurance types.

Property insurance protects your business’s physical property from damage or theft.

Liability insurance protects your business from lawsuits alleging that your business caused someone else’s injury or damage to their property.

Workers’ compensation insurance benefits injured employees working for your business. It is a must for companies with employees.

Businesses also often purchase Professional liability insurance that protects businesses from lawsuits alleging that their professional services caused someone’s financial loss.

How Much Does Business Insurance In Phoenix, Arizona Usually, Cost?

Business insurance is vital to running a successful company, but how much does it cost?

On average, business insurance costs between $500 and $3,000 per year, depending on the size and type of business. However, some businesses may need to pay more for coverage if they’re in a high-risk industry or have a lot of employees.

Of course, this is just an average, and your actual costs may be higher or lower depending on your specific circumstances. However, this amount is a reasonable ballpark estimate for most small businesses.

Is Business Insurance Paid Monthly?

There are a few options for paying business insurance, but monthly payments are the most common. This payment method offers several advantages to businesses, making it the best option for most companies.

Paying business insurance monthly allows businesses to spread out the cost of their insurance over time, making it more affordable. Monthly payments make it easier to budget for and keep track of expenses. 

It also allows businesses to cancel or change their policy if necessary without a significant penalty.

However, some insurers may offer discounts for paying in total upfront. So it’s always worth checking with your insurer to see if discounts are available.

How To Save On Business Insurance In Phoenix, Arizona

Business insurance is a vital part of any business but it can be expensive. There are a few ways to save on business insurance in Phoenix, Arizona.

One way to save on business insurance is to shop around. Don’t just accept the first quote you receive. Get quotes from several companies to ensure you get the best rate.

Another way to save is to bundle your business insurance with other types, such as your homeowners or auto insurance. This can often give you a discount.

Make sure you understand exactly what coverages you need for your business. This will help you avoid paying for coverage you don’t need.
